Fiction and nonfiction books published by actually autistic authors -- not allistic parents, teachers, doctors, caregivers, etc. of autistic people. Books in this list do not have to be about autism, but they MUST be by autistic authors.

Pleas add to your books. Mind Tree Author Tito Rajarshi Mukhopadhyay. A miraculous child breaks the silence of autism. Available from the National Autism Society and Arcade Books, NY. www.arcadepub.com ISBN: 978-1-61145-002-6. Includes 2 other books and a book of poems--written when Tito was 8, 11, and older.This is an excellent book for parents of an autistic child as well as the child himself. Tito uses long words in complex sentences and expresses philosophical thoughts. " 'Can nothing be changed with me?' I ask the clock which tells me stories. But I understand that somethings need waiting. I get ready to wait for the green color of hope which would cover me all through. There may be different colors around me, but the clock told me that everything will be greenish."
Tito's writing is not corrected or edited. It is in United Kingdom English, though; Tito was born in India. I cried when the book was finished and hope to share it with my two autistic grandsons and the rest of their family. Please add this book to your list.
